| Features:
| • | Flexible, silicone design | | • | Heat resistant to up to 600-Fahrenheit | | • | Square-shaped cups form an easy-pour spout at the corner | | • | Invert cup to remove sticky ingredients | | • | Measurements marked on inside and bottom of cups |

Versatile and fun January 6, 2009 These measuring cups are great quality and colorful. There are especially good to measure sticky peanut butter or icing - these flip inside out so you can easily get the contents out and clean them. When I first started using silcone kitchen items, I was skeptical but now I love them!
Easy Storage November 1, 2008 This is a nice little measuring cup set that is easy to store because the containers nest together. You do need to hold them when u fill them with flour or milk, etc. because they will tip over; they're kind of soft and flexible, but I don't mind that. They're also easy to find in your drawer, because they're colorful. AND they would make great toys for small children and babies to play with.
silicone measuring cups October 3, 2008 1 out of 1 found this review helpful
These are easy to handle and use. They are especially useful when you need to heat a small amount of something before adding it to the mixture--like chocolate or butter--because they are microwave and oven safe.
So-so, and very spillable August 8, 2008 4 out of 5 found this review helpful
These are not as great as I thought they would be. The colors are muddy-looking, not nice and bright as they are in the photo. The silicone does not seem to be of as high quality as other silicone products I have. Something about the texture and relative thinness just seems cheap, almost as if the silicone is a bit porous. (I haven't used it enough yet to figure out whether it holds odors, though.) Most significantly, the small base makes these cups VERY easy to tip over. I had hoped to use them when traveling, to do double duty in serving pudding, dipping sauces, etc., but they are just too tippable for that. I wish somebody would come out with a higher-quality set of stackable silicone measuring cups with more stable bases, classier colors and heavier-weight silicone, with a smooth (not pebbly) interior.
